TikTok kicked off global campaign and creative video series #CreateKindness Wednesday with the aim of raising awareness around online bullying and how we can all choose kindness.

Director of creator community, TikTok U.S. Kudzi Chikumbu and director of policy, TikTok U.S. Tara Wadhwa said in a blog post Wednesday that videos on the platform using hashtags related to kindness have tallied over 400 billion views and generated almost 50 billion video creations globally, adding that heart stickers and creative effects have been added to more than 2 billion videos worldwide in the past year, most often in Brazil, Indonesia, Mexico, the Philippines and the U.S.
